Output 27086cf2d7ef042693f78236bb2bd1268d187c2e2aaef5687b8b9f2889298d3b:0

value
515800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b19c0b3b6310c06b9758f64d201c146c0379e37f OP_EQUAL
address
3Ht8TchJ2yo44XfqFYbrbzHsHdWWSaKzzC
transaction
27086cf2d7ef042693f78236bb2bd1268d187c2e2aaef5687b8b9f2889298d3b
spent
true